About the role
Reporting to the Coordinator of Building Services, the Building Surveyor will play a vital role in accessing and processing building applications while ensuring strict adherence to all relevant building legislation, regulations, codes, policies, and procedures.
The Building Surveyor will also provide professional technical advice on building matters to both internal and externa stakeholders, conduct inspections, and address minor compliance issues.
About the successful candidate
The ideal candidate will possess prior experience in a similar role, preferably within a Local Government context and demonstrate a thorough knowledge and understanding of relevant building surveying legislation, regulations, and statutory requirements.
Other essential requirements:
- Advanced Diploma (or working towards) in Building Surveying or equivalent qualification approved by the Building Services Board.
- Registration as Level 2 Building Surveying Practitioner or Level 3 Technician with the Department of Energy, Mines, Industry Regulations and Safety.
- Construction Induction “White Card”.
- Sound customer service, interpersonal, and communication skills.
- Strong research, report writing, and problem-solving skills.
- Current “C” class Drivers Licence.
- Current National Police Certificate.
